WebSep 8, 2024 · Catastrophic hurricane damage on Sept. 8, 1900. (Library of Congress) On the night of Sept. 8, the Category 4 hurricane came onshore with 936 mb pressure, winds between 130-156 mph and a storm surge of 15 feet.
